About Trinidad
Trinidad was created in 1969 as a diplomatic gift cigar, produced at the El Laguito factory alongside Cohiba. For nearly three decades, Trinidad cigars were available only to heads of state and foreign dignitaries. When finally released commercially in 1998, the Fundadores became one of the most sought-after Cuban cigars ever produced.
History
Trinidad is created at El Laguito as an exclusive diplomatic gift cigar, even more restricted than Cohiba.
After nearly 30 years as a state secret, Trinidad is released commercially with the Fundadores — a Lancero-format cigar.
The Reyes and Coloniales expand the range, making the brand more accessible while maintaining exclusivity.
The Topes is released, adding a modern Robusto Extra format to this prestigious brand.

Were Trinidad cigars really only for diplomats?
Yes, from 1969 to 1998, Trinidad was produced exclusively at El Laguito as a diplomatic gift. Only heads of state and senior diplomats received them. They were commercially released in 1998.
